“…The results were in agreement with those obtained by other researchers who indicated that biogas digestate may be a potential alternative for the replacement of mineral fertilizers with alternative organic fertilizers (Barbosa, Nabel, & Jablonowski, ; Cavalli et al., ; Haraldsen, Andersen, Krogstad, & Sorheim, ; Koszel & Lorencowicz, ; Riva et al., ; Sapp, Harrison, Hany, Charlton, & Thwaites, ). Researchers have reported that even over a short period, digestate could be as effective as mineral N fertilizer, based on studies with Sida hermaphrodita L., Zea mays L. and Medicago sativa L. (Barbosa et al., ; Koszel & Lorencowicz, ). On the other hand, digestate fertilization (at 5 t DM ha −1 ) of S. hermaphrodita grown on marginal soil conditions showed no significant effect on biomass yield in the short term (Nabel, Barbosa, Horsch, & Jablonowski, ).…”

“…One can apply the digestate directly on the arable fields, others can also separate it into solid fraction and effluent. The liquid fraction can be used for irrigating fields or can be simply returned to the chamber digestion to hydrate the batch [15,16]. In turn, the solid fraction can be directly applied to the field, composted, or be used to produce pellets for heating purposes, and incinerated.…”
